Premiere: Floyd Lavine & William Kiss unite on COCO for high-energy collaboration ‘Hypnotize’, featuring Liam Mockridge

Thomas Gaboury-Potvin
News, Premieres, Tech House
19 September 2025

COCO keeps the pressure high with a major collaborative debut as Floyd Lavine and William Kiss join forces for the very first time on their new single ‘Hypnotize’, featuring the commanding vocal presence of Berlin-based recording artist and producer Liam Mockridge (Soul Clap Records/Good Crazy). Marking a bold, energy-fueled release,

‘Hypnotize’ brings together the deep grooves of Floyd Lavine and the driving rhythms of William Kiss, a standout of the new-school house wave and an artist who has quickly become a BBC Radio 1 favourite. The result is a groove-fuelled trip laced with trippy vocal work from Mockridge, a track that feels equally suited to sunrise sets and peak-time floors. A self-proclaimed ‘African Nomad,

’Floyd Lavine is a celebrated artist whose work spans across afrohouse, techno, house, and disco, with acclaimed releases on labels like Innervisions and Ninja Tune. Known for his emotionally charged DJ sets and his visionary imprint Afrikan Tales, Lavine continues to push boundaries with every project. William Kiss, meanwhile, has rapidly become one of the scene’s most intriguing names with releases on Rekids, Gudu Records, Three Six Zero, and more.

With a percussive, bass-heavy signature and over a million streams to his name, his music lands with intention; powerful, direct, and built to move rooms.

‘Hypnotize’ is the electrifying melting pot of three creative forces from around the globe. It’s a release that speaks to COCO’s ethos of championing fresh, future-facing house music while bridging scenes and continents, and with the label riding high into the second half of 2025, this one’s a standout that demands attention.
